Lions 2013: The Wallabies name a squad…

Posted 68 days ago

PULSES HAVE been set racing south of the equator as Robbie Deans named a preliminary Australia squad to meet for an ‘exercise’ this Sunday, omitting Quade Cooper but naming Waratah Israel Folau in his 30-man group.

England v Australia: The Preview

Posted 215 days ago

AUSTRALIA HAVE made the short hop over the channel after their heavy loss to France still talking the talk, yet negativity seems to follow them like a bad odour at present with legendary Wallaby wing David Campese wading in earlier this week with some typically acerbic quotes saying ‘Deans had destroyed Australian rugby and I want him to go’.

Wallabies unchanged for second Wales Test

Posted 372 days ago

Robbie Deans has named an unchanged line-up for Saturday night’s second Test against Wales in Melbourne.
Despite concerns over the fitness of Sekope Kepu, after he strained a tendon in his forearm during last weekend’s 27-19 win over Wales in the first match of the series, the tighthead prop has been named subject to proving his readiness later in the week.
